Economic Ties: The Push and Pull Between Neighbors
Let's shift gears and talk about the economic side of the India Pakistan relationship. It's a fascinating, albeit often strained, aspect of their interactions. When you look at the potential for trade and economic cooperation, it's staggering to think about what could be achieved if relations were more stable. Both countries have large populations, growing economies, and a shared history that, if leveraged positively, could foster significant mutual benefit. However, political tensions often cast a long shadow over economic possibilities. Trade relations have been historically up and down, heavily influenced by the security and political climate. For example, following certain incidents, trade might be suspended or tariffs increased, impacting businesses on both sides. The Times of India, for instance, might report on specific trade figures, highlight the impact of trade disruptions on industries, or discuss potential avenues for economic engagement. There's often a debate within both countries about the extent to which economic ties should be pursued independently of political issues. Some argue that fostering trade can actually help build trust and create a more conducive environment for political dialogue. Others believe that until core political and security issues are resolved, any significant economic progress will be superficial and unsustainable. We're talking about sectors like textiles, agriculture, and pharmaceuticals, where there's natural synergy and a huge market waiting to be tapped. The potential for job creation, economic growth, and improved living standards is immense. Yet, the reality on the ground often involves bureaucratic hurdles, non-tariff barriers, and a general sense of caution driven by the unpredictable political climate. Cultural Connections: Bridging Divides Through Shared Heritage
Beyond the headlines about politics and economics, there's a deep well of shared culture and heritage that connects India and Pakistan. It’s this aspect that often reminds people that despite the political divides, there’s a lot of common ground. Think about the music, the films, the literature, and even the food – much of it is shared, originating from a common past before the partition. When we look at India Pakistan news, especially in publications like the Times of India, there are often features that highlight these cultural connections. These stories might showcase artists collaborating across borders, discussions about shared literary traditions, or even the enduring popularity of Pakistani music in India, and vice versa. These cultural exchanges, though sometimes overshadowed by political tensions, are incredibly important. They serve as a powerful reminder of the human element in the relationship, fostering understanding and empathy on a people-to-people level. These shared cultural touchstones are arguably the most resilient aspect of the relationship, capable of weathering many political storms. For instance, the love for certain genres of music or the appreciation for classical art forms transcends political boundaries. Similarly, the culinary landscapes of both nations are deeply intertwined, with dishes and flavors celebrated on both sides of the border.
